• What is usual time required to reach deep flow state ?

  • The specific time required to reach a deep flow state is not explicitly detailed in available Huberman Lab data. However, Andrew Huberman emphasizes the importance of minimizing distractions to achieve a focused state, which suggests that the time can vary based on individual circumstances and environmental factors.

    Generally, achieving a deep focus or flow state often requires an initial period of concentrated effort, which can range from several minutes to longer, depending on the person's level of engagement with the task and their ability to maintain attention.

    It might be useful to create a structured routine and environments conducive to focus to facilitate quicker transitions into deep work, but exact timeframes can differ widely among individuals.
